I'm LongbridgeAI, I can summarize articles.The FMS 2026 Flash Memory Summit officially opened today and will run until August 6. The first day was packed with major announcements, including SK Hynix and SanDisk releasing the first industry standard for HBF, establishing a new storage tier between HBM and SSD to directly address the "memory wall" pain point in AI computing power; Samsung and SK Hynix also successively shared their next-generation AI storage architecture plans.
